On 02/07/2014 06:02 AM, Guenter Roeck wrote: > arch/c6x/include/asm/cache.h uses __init and thus needs to include init.h. > This fixes the following c6x build error. > > arch/c6x/include/asm/cache.h:63:20: error: expected '=', ',', ';', > 'asm' or '__attribute__' before 'c6x_cache_init' > extern void __init c6x_cache_init(void); > > Problem was inadvertendly introduced with commit c28aa1f > (printk/cache: mark printk_once test variable __read_mostly). > > Cc: Joe Perches <joe@perches.com> > Signed-off-by: Guenter Roeck <linux@roeck-us.net> > --- > arch/c6x/include/asm/cache.h | 1 + > 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+) > > diff --git a/arch/c6x/include/asm/cache.h b/arch/c6x/include/asm/cache.h > index 09c5a0f..86648c0 100644 > --- a/arch/c6x/include/asm/cache.h > +++ b/arch/c6x/include/asm/cache.h > @@ -12,6 +12,7 @@ > #define _ASM_C6X_CACHE_H > > #include <linux/irqflags.h> > +#include <linux/init.h> > > /* > * Cache line size >
ping ... c6x builds still fail in mainline due to this problem. Anyone interested in a fix ?
